Tyson Fury’s Wife Paris Endured Miscarriage the Day Before His Fight with Usyk

Tyson Fury, the renowned British boxer, recently shared a heartbreaking revelation about facing a personal tragedy just before his match against Oleksandr Usyk. It was only upon his return home to Morecambe that Fury discovered the devastating news. His wife, Paris, was six months pregnant with their eighth child, a boy, but tragically suffered a miscarriage on the eve of Fury’s fight in Saudi Arabia in May.

In a candid interview, Fury disclosed that he had been unaware of the miscarriage before the fight, as Paris had shielded him from the news to allow him to focus on becoming the division’s first undisputed champion in 24 years. Despite his loss to Usyk, Fury reflected on the immense emotional turmoil he endured during the ordeal.

The heavyweight boxer expressed his deep regret at not being able to be by Paris’s side during such a difficult time. Paris, who was unable to attend the fight due to health concerns, braved the loss and physical challenges alone while Fury fought in a foreign country. Fury recounted the heart-wrenching experience of knowing something was amiss when Paris couldn’t join him in Riyadh and later confirming the miscarriage upon his return.

While the tragedy deeply affected Fury, he emphasised that it did not impact his performance in the ring against Usyk. Looking ahead, Fury hinted at a potential rematch with Usyk on December 21, albeit without the IBF belt at stake, as Usyk chose to relinquish it instead of defending it mandatorily, with Daniel Dubois now holding the title. Fury remained resolute in his determination to honour his commitments in the ring, despite grappling with personal grief.
